It’s Your Government: Public Records

May 3, 2007

What Can I Get? Massachusetts Public Record Law defines “public records” as “all documentary materials or data, regardless of physical form or characteristics . . . . [including] all photographs, papers and electronic storage media including electronic mail” either made or received. There are some exceptions, including those for public safety, medical records, and test [...]
